Back From The Depths: Fishbone Reborn

There’s a lot of nostalgia for the ’80s and ’90s these days. TV shows like Stranger Things have re-awoken that yearning for the aesthetic of decades past. For those of us who grew up in this era there is something comforting about the colors, style and music of our childhood years.

Keeping this throwback spirit alive, ska/punk legends Fishbone have reunited their original lineup to hit the road, bringing their unique combination of goofy, socially conscious horn-driven rock to fans worldwide.

According to bassist and founding member Norwood Fisher:

“It’s absolutely unreal, at this stage of the game, to be reunited as brothers and bandmates! The band feels as if it’s almost firing better than ever.”

This summer, fall back in to the days when MTV actually played music videos, giant festivals like Vans Warped Tour and Lollapalooza toured the nation and people were genuinely excited to embrace the heat of summer in the middle of a mosh pit. Some things haven’t changed, but it’s still always fun to pine a little for the past. And in the mean time, make sure to catch Fishbone on tour in select cities this summer.
